Putting digital trust and safety into operation is a daunting job. It affects everything from the development of online products to setting standards, deploying internal teams and enforcing policies. It’s also too big of a job to do alone. Implementing an effective digital trust and safety culture requires partnering with social, government, law enforcement and technology organizations. These third parties can share useful information and meaningful insight around risk and best practices.
